YPBC is excited to announce that special guest speaker, Dr. Katharine Hayhoe, will join Rev. Dr. Peter Holmes in a unique dialogue sermon on the theme of the Stewardship of Creation.

We welcome Dr. Hayhoe to our pulpit in the hope of not only coming to terms with the truth, but expecting a Gospel word of hope and grace in the midst.

Time Magazine recently named Katharine Hayhoe one of the one hundred most influential people in the world. The PBS show, Nova, featured Katharine Hayhoe and referred to her as the climate change evangelist.

Don Cheadle, actor and correspondent for Showtime's, Years of Living Dangerously, said, "I've never heard of anyone like Katharine Hayhoe, an evangelical climate scientist?" He went on to feature her work and her voice prominently in the premier episode of the award winning show.

Katharine Hayhoe's mission as a scientist is to help the faith community come to terms with one of the greatest challenges of our age, climate change.
